Trapped in your own way

Alexander Dunn 2006 (Indiana)



A grassy texture. Its all I felt in the undertale. As a person like me finds a path to light. All I see is night, but tho I struggle I keep myself up for I think Im enough. As i go deeper to find a way. I think and think of what dismay. What it bad. Was it good. I'll never know because it was a dream. A game that played tricks on me. When I struggled and wiggled to get out of that place. It was just all the past trauma that happened to me, but as I say you keep getting up you will always be enough. See you another day.
